Shared versioned state store with optimistic concurrency control for coordinating concurrent AI agents. SQLite-backed claim/release locks and append-only audit log.
Connect Scrivener 3 writing projects to Claude and other AI assistants. 47 tools for document management, writing analysis, semantic search, character/plot memory, and content enhancement. Progressive skill loading, relationship engine with HMS triplets, and JS fallback for offline semantic search. npm i -g scrivener-mcp

Agenthold Tools (5)
agenthold_register
Register yourself and receive a unique agent ID. Must be called once before using `agenthold_claim` or `agenthold_release`.
agenthold_claim
Claim exclusive access to a resource before modifying it. Requires a registered `agent_id`.
agenthold_release
Release your claim with an explicit outcome describing what you did. The outcome is preserved in the free-state record and shown to the next claimant so they don't act on stale assumptions. Requires a registered `agent_id`.
agenthold_status
Check whether a resource is available or currently claimed. Does not require registration.
agenthold_wait
Wait for a claimed resource to become available. Blocks the agent turn until the holder releases, or the timeout expires.
